LONDON, England – John Holland-Kaye, Chief Executive of Heathrow Airport, has been confirmed as the guest speaker at this year’s Tourism Society Annual Dinner.

The dinner will be held on Monday 21 March at the House of Lords, with up to 120 members and guests of the Tourism Society attending.

Holland-Kaye joined Heathrow as Commercial Director in 2009 and took over as Chief Executive in July 2014 after seeing retail income per passenger grow by 10% per annum and passenger satisfaction increase significantly to over 70%.
